Bangkok Temples, Food, and Nightlife Extravaganza

Bangkok Temples, Food, and Nightlife Extravaganza Itinerary

Last updated: 2024 Jun 14

Temples and Culinary Delights

Morning
Start your spiritual journey with a visit to the iconic "Grand Palace" and the revered "Temple of the Emerald Buddha (Wat Phra Kaew)." After immersing yourself in the rich history and culture, take a short walk to the "Temple of the Reclining Buddha (Wat Pho)."
Afternoon
For lunch, savor authentic Thai flavors at "Thip Samai Pad Thai," a renowned spot for this classic dish. Afterward, explore the "Marble Temple (Wat Benchamabophit)" and the "Golden Mount (Wat Saket)" for panoramic views of the city.
Evening
Indulge in a fine dining experience at "Gaggan," a multi-award winning restaurant offering innovative Indian cuisine. Conclude your evening with a leisurely walk at "Asiatique The Riverfront," enjoying the vibrant atmosphere and stunning views of the Chao Phraya River.

Cultural Immersion and Gastronomic Delights

Morning
Embark on a cultural adventure with a visit to the ancient city of "Ayutthaya," exploring the magnificent ruins and temples. Enjoy a traditional Thai lunch at "Baan Khanitha & Gallery" before returning to Bangkok.
Afternoon
Spend the afternoon at the "Jim Thompson House Museum," a treasure trove of art and antiques. Afterward, take a relaxing stroll in the lush greenery of "Lumpini Park."
Evening
For dinner, experience the unique flavors of "Bo.Lan," a restaurant dedicated to traditional Thai recipes. Afterward, head to the vibrant "Khao San Road" for a taste of Bangkok's nightlife.

Market Adventures and Muay Thai Thrills

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the "Damnoen Saduak Floating Market," where you can immerse yourself in the bustling atmosphere and sample local delicacies. On your way back to Bangkok, stop at the "Maeklong Railway Market" to witness the unique sight of a train passing through the market.
Afternoon
Enjoy a late lunch at "100 Mahaseth," known for its innovative take on traditional Thai c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the "Mahanakhon SkyWalk" for panoramic views of the city.
Evening
Conclude your trip with an exhilarating evening at the "Rajadamnern Stadium," watching authentic Muay Thai boxing. Before the match, enjoy a sumptuous dinner at "Sra Bua by Kiin Kiin," a Michelin-starred restaurant offering a modern twist on Thai flavors.
